>> We run Ansible with great success. We use Ansible to provision the server
>> and keep all Kamailio related code in a git-repo. Ansible has two tasks,
>> (1) to provision the server according to business security standards and
>> all sub-deps, and (2) to update the server when new code is commited to the
>> repo.
>>
>> On new code, it would then setup all dirs, restart Kamailio etc as needed.
>>
>> We use the same logic and setup for Asterisk and have been doing that in
>> production for a few years without any issues whatsoever.

>> Did you start with it and stayed with, or you compared and found some
>> benefits vs. others like ansible, puppet, ...?
>>
>> I started with ansible and happy with it, when I looked around the
>> reasons were that python was installed anyhow by default in debian, then
>> the target system didn't need to have any server/agent app deployed
>> before.
